The Opportunity

Relocation assistance is available for this position. We offer a flexible work environment requiring an individual to be in the office 4 days per week. This position can be based in one of the following locations: San Antonio, TX, Plano, TX, Phoenix, AZ, Colorado Springs, CO, Charlotte, NC, or Tampa, FL.

This role is part of our Property Pricing State Team handling forecasting analytics. You will independently apply actuarial methods for accurate pricing and process improvement, mentor colleagues, provide strategic insights, and manage business risks in compliance with internal risk management policies.

Responsibilities

  • Independently apply actuarial methodologies to complete structured projects (e.g., build tools to test and implement new methodologies that improve accuracy of actuarial analysis; utilize model results to select new variables and refresh existing variables in a rating algorithm; analyze results from multiple methodologies to propose reserve selections and document rationale).
  • Identify and improve existing processes utilizing actuarial, mathematical, or statistical techniques.
  • Proactively resolve technical issues and identify appropriate issues for escalation.
  • Assist others with troubleshooting issues.
  • Create instructions and training materials for actuarial tools and processes.
  • Mentor new team members.
  • Apply business acumen to provide actionable insights that help solve business problems.
  • Effectively communicate insights and solutions to broad audiences including actuarial and non-actuarial stakeholders.
  • Ensure risks associated with business activities are effectively identified, measured, monitored, and controlled in accordance with risk and compliance policies and procedures.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ree or 4 years of related actuarial/business/analytical experience (in addition to the minimum years of experience required) may be substituted in lieu of degree.
  • 2 years of actuarial or analytical business experience.
  • 3 Casualty Actuarial Society (CAS) exams.
  • Experience with relevant actuarial, mathematical, and statistical techniques and approaches used to support fact-based decision-making.
  • Intermediate knowledge of data analysis tools, data visualization, developing analysis queries and procedures in Python, R, SQL, SAS, BI tools, or other analysis software, and relevant industry data & methods and ability to connect technical insights to business problems.
